{{Incomplete}}'''[[Wikipedia:IFTTT|IFTTT]]''' initially offered a subscription plan marketed as a "lifetime" deal. Users were promised that the price would stay the same as long as the plan was active. After about three years, however, IFTTT discontinued the original plan, forcing users into a new, more expensive subscription tier. | ||

In 2020, IFTTT launched the ''"Set Your Price"'' campaign for its Pro subscription. The campaign included the following promises:<blockquote>"If you upgrade to Pro before October 31st, whatever price you choose will be what you pay per month forever."<ref name="archive1">[https://web.archive.org/web/20201025203841/https://ifttt.com/explore/set_your_price_extended IFTTT: Set Your Price for Pro – Web Archive, October 25, 2020]</ref> | In 2020, IFTTT launched the ''"Set Your Price"'' campaign for its Pro subscription.
